surplus value

the difference between the value produced by labor and the wages paid to laborers, which capitalists exploit for profit.

evolutionary socialism

achieving socialist goals through gradual reforms within existing political systems, rather than through revolutionary means.

8
New cards

fabianism

a movement advocating gradual socialism through democratic means and reform.

9
New cards

Keynesianism

an economic theory advocating for government intervention to manage economic cycles and promote full employment.
